Understanding the Basics of Connecting JBL Speakers Together

Here are four methods to connect your JBL speakers together:

  1. Method 1: Wireless Bluetooth Connection: The easiest and most convenient way to connect your JBL speakers is through a wireless Bluetooth connection. Simply enable Bluetooth on both speakers, pair them with your device, and voila! You can now enjoy synchronized audio playback.
  2. Method 2: Wired Connection Using Aux Cable: If you prefer a wired connection, you can use an auxiliary cable to connect the audio outputs of two JBL speakers. Plug one end of the aux cable into the headphone jack of one speaker and the other end into the AUX IN port of the second speaker. This method provides a stable connection without relying on Bluetooth.
  3. Method 3: Using an Audio Splitter: Another option is using an audio splitter to connect multiple JBL speakers together. Simply plug one end of the splitter into your audio source (such as a smartphone or laptop) and connect each speaker to a separate output of the splitter. This allows for simultaneous playback across all connected speakers.
  4. Method 4: Speaker Pairing Feature: Some JBL speaker models offer a built-in pairing feature that allows you to easily link two or more speakers together. Check your speaker’s user manual or manufacturer’s website to see if this feature is available for your model. Simply follow the instructions provided to activate speaker pairing and enjoy enhanced stereo sound.

Step 5: Connect the Two JBL Speakers

  1. Prepare the speaker: Ensure that both JBL speakers are fully charged and turned off. This will help ensure a smooth connection process.
  2. Turn on the first speaker: Press and hold the power button on the first JBL speaker until it powers on. You may hear a sound or see a light indicator to confirm that it is properly turned on.
  3. Enable pairing mode: On the first speaker, locate the Bluetooth pairing button or switch and activate it. This will put the speaker in pairing mode, allowing it to connect with other devices.
  4. Connect your phone or device: Open the Bluetooth settings on your phone or device and select the first JBL speaker from the list of available devices. Once connected, you should hear a confirmation sound or see an indicator that shows you are connected.
  5. Turn on the second speaker: Repeat step 2 for the second JBL speaker, ensuring that it is also in pairing mode.
  6. Connect both speakers: On your phone or device, go to the Bluetooth settings again and select the second JBL speaker from the list of available devices. Once connected, you should now have both speakers linked together for an enhanced audio experience.

Additionally, make sure that both speakers are within range of each other to maintain a stable connection. Keep in mind that specific models of JBL speakers may have slight variations in their pairing process, so referring to their respective user manuals can provide more accurate instructions.
